SL DP Chemistry

Practice calculations involving Iodine number

1. Define IODINE NUMBER (also known as iodine index).

TYPE 1 QUESTIONS: determine the Iodine number from the formula.


2. Linoelic acid (Mr = 281 gmol-1) has a formula of

CH3(CH2)4CH=CHCH2CH=CH(CH2)7COOH.

a. Draw its structural formula.

b. Determine how many moles of double bonds 1 mol of the fatty acid
has.

c. Calculate the number of moles of Iodine (I2) that reacts with 1 mol of
the fatty acid.

TYPE 2 QUESTIONS: calculate the number of double bonds.

5. A 5.0 g sample of vegetable oil has reacted completely with 38 mL of a 0.50


mol dm-3 iodine solution. What is the iodine number of the oil?

a. Calculate the number of moles of iodine reacted.

b. Calculate the mass of iodine that reacted (in g).

c. Calculate the iodine number using the formula:


Mass of I 2reacted , g
x 100
Mass of oil , g

d. Now calculate the mass of iodine 1 mol of the oil would react with
using the equation:
Iodine number
x Molar mass of oil
100

e. Now calculate the number of mol of iodine this would be.
